Applicants must be Nigerian citizens or legal residents currently residing in Nigeria, at least 18 years old at the time of registration, and have no criminal convictions or ongoing legal disputes. Only individual entries are allowed, and participants must be available to live in the TAT residence for the entire competition duration.

All applications must be submitted through the official The Art Titan website. Applicants need to provide accurate personal information, a short biography, portfolio samples, a recent passport photograph, and pay a non-refundable registration fee. Submission of false information or forged documents will lead to disqualification.

There is a non-refundable registration fee for interested applicants during the course of registration, payable through Paystack during the registration process in Step 2 (Basic Information). Payment must be completed to proceed with the application.

Applicants must upload original artwork in JPEG/PNG format (max 5MB) or MP4 format (max 20MB). The artwork must not have been used in any other competition to avoid disqualification.

TAT reserves the right to disqualify participants for breaching terms and conditions. Participants who voluntarily withdraw may forfeit rights to recognition, prizes, or artworks created during the show.

Applicants must provide details such as full name, email, phone number, date of birth (ensuring they are at least 18), nationality (Nigeria), NIN, BVN, state of origin, next-of-kin details, and information about disabilities or allergies, if applicable. All fields must be accurately completed to avoid disqualification.
